Asian Carp Kevin Rose | Smithsonian Environmental Research Center Asian Carp is a common name usually used to describe several species of invasive fish in the U.S. Typically, this includes black carp (Mylopharyngodon piceus), bighead carp (Hypophthalmichthys nobilis), and silver carp (H. molitrix).
